I don't have the manual near by, but I thought you needed a straight run on both sides of the unit like at least a foot. I would read the manual to insure that it's installed correctly. Not sure if it would shorten the life or it doesn't generate enough chlorine or why the run is necessary, but everything I've read about these units, you are supposed to have a straight run on both sides. The reason given in the manual for the straight pipe (12-18", I believe) is for flow sensing. Mine is plumbed similarly (right after a 90), and when my 1hp 2-speed pump is on low, the cell usually gives a flow error (unless I have just recently backwashed the filter). On high it's ok.

I'm not positive that having a straight section of pipe would enable it to work on low, but it's certainly a possibility.

Yes it calls to have a straight run ahead of it. I suspect this is to have as laminar flow as possible as it enters the cell. It wasn't really feasible with my setup though. I don't see any way that it could effect chlorine production though. As someone above said; it's most likely to give the flow switch optimum conditions to give an error free indication. There is a stream straightener in the end of the cell just ahead of the switch also.
 
As far as shortening the life of it, I can't really see how it could make a difference either. Water balance and on-time are the two major things that dictate cell life according to what I've read on the subject.
